A further threat posed by climate change is the alteration of migratory patterns & the impact on food availability in their habitats. The environments that sustain Rummy Eagles may become less hospitable as temperatures rise and weather patterns change. Conservation Activities and Difficulties. In addition, illegal hunting and poaching are still issues in some areas where these birds are sought after for trade or sport. Prospects and Safety for the Future. To properly monitor populations and lessen these threats, conservation efforts are crucial.

In order to protect themselves from predators on the ground, nests are typically constructed atop tall trees or cliffs. For each clutch, the female usually lays one to three eggs, which she then incubates for roughly forty-five days. During this time, the male and female share duties; the male hunts for food to support them both while the female incubates the eggs. The chicks are altricial after hatching, which means they are defenseless at birth and depend solely on their parents for protection & sustenance.

*Aquila nipalensis*, the scientific name for the Rummy Eagle, is a captivating predator that has gained notoriety for its amazing hunting skills and eye-catching appearance. A member of the Accipitridae family, which also includes vultures, hawks, and kites, is this species, commonly known as the Steppe Eagle. Large swaths of Central Asia are home to the Rummy Eagle, especially in areas with open grasslands and steppe habitats. Its distinctive ruffled neck feathers, which give it a regal appearance, are the source of its name.
